The broader arc of the Dallas Mavericks\u2019 season told another. In a 135\u2013123 loss to the San Antonio Spurs, Dallas was again undone by defensive lapses, second-chance opportunities, and late-game execution against a deeper, more cohesive opponent. <\/p>\n<p>The defeat dropped the Mavericks to 23\u201328, extending their losing streak to six games and leaving them ranked 12th in the Western Conference.<\/p>\n<p>Yet the night also reinforced a reality that has quietly crystallized over recent weeks: the Mavericks are now operating on a new axis, one centered squarely on the rapid rise of <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/f\/flaggco01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Cooper Flagg<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p>Flagg scored 32 points for the fourth consecutive game, extending a historic rookie streak and continuing a surge that has placed him among the most productive first-year players the league has seen in decades. Alongside him, <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/m\/marshna01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Naji Marshall<\/a> matched that output with 32 of his own, as the two combined for 64 points in a performance that kept Dallas competitive well into the fourth quarter.<\/p>\n<p>Still, the Spurs \u2014 who improved to 35\u201316 and remain firmly entrenched near the top of the Western Conference \u2014 proved steadier when it mattered most. Led by <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/w\/wembavi01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Victor Wembanyama<\/a>, San Antonio closed the game with timely shot-making and ball movement to halt a Mavericks rally and pull away late.<\/p>\n<p>San Antonio Spurs Set the Tone Early<\/p>\n<p>From the opening possessions, San Antonio established control with spacing, pace, and purpose. Wembanyama immediately altered the geometry of the floor, knocking down his first five three-point attempts and forcing Dallas to defend well beyond the arc. His shooting range pulled the Mavericks\u2019 bigs into uncomfortable territory and opened lanes for cutters and ball-handlers to attack a defense already short on continuity.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t looked like he wasn\u2019t going to miss tonight,\u201d Mavericks coach <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/k\/kiddja01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Jason Kidd<\/a> said. \u201cHe was really good on both ends.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The pressure manifested most clearly on the glass. In the first half, Dallas struggled to finish defensive possessions, allowing the Spurs to extend trips and generate extra opportunities. Those second chances prevented the Mavericks from building momentum even as their offense found pockets of success.<\/p>\n<p>Despite that, Kidd noted the group\u2019s resilience. \u201cEven with him making every shot, I thought the group stayed together,\u201d he said. \u201cIn the second half, the guys fought.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Adjustments by Dallas Mavericks After the Break<\/p>\n<p>Coming out of halftime, Dallas focused on physicality and discipline, particularly in its coverage of Wembanyama. The adjustments did not neutralize him \u2014 few ever do \u2014 but they slowed San Antonio\u2019s rhythm and forced the Spurs into tougher looks.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cHe was a little human there,\u201d Kidd said. \u201cUnderstanding that you just have to try to be physical. He might make some shots, but he also missed some shots.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The Mavericks also cleaned up the glass and pushed the ball more decisively, turning defensive stops into transition opportunities. That shift allowed Flagg to take control of the game offensively, attacking mismatches and scoring from all three levels as the Spurs\u2019 lead steadily shrank.<\/p>\n<p>Flagg did most of his damage after halftime, pouring in 22 points while orchestrating Dallas\u2019 comeback. His scoring came in a variety of ways \u2014 drives through traffic, pull-up jumpers and timely finishes \u2014 but it was his composure that stood out most.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I think that\u2019s the consistency,\u201d Flagg said. \u201cShowing up every day and being able to be consistent in who I am and what I can provide.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>A Late Push, and the Difference in Execution<\/p>\n<p>Dallas eventually pulled within one possession, entering familiar territory for a team that has played a league-leading 34 clutch games this season. The Mavericks generated quality looks and continued to pressure San Antonio defensively, but the margin for error remained slim.<\/p>\n<p>That margin disappeared late in the fourth quarter.<\/p>\n<p>After Dallas came up empty on consecutive possessions, <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/f\/foxde01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">De\u2019Aaron Fox<\/a> drilled a three-pointer with 1:24 remaining, a shot assisted by Wembanyama that pushed the Spurs back up eight and effectively sealed the outcome.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t was big,\u201d Kidd said. \u201cWe had some good looks, and they made the big ones going down the stretch.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The sequence encapsulated the night: Dallas competed, adjusted and threatened, but San Antonio executed with precision when the game demanded it.<\/p>\n<p>Cooper Flagg and Naji Marshall, Growing in Tandem<\/p>\n<p>Even in defeat, the partnership between Flagg and Marshall continued to deepen. With injuries forcing role expansion across the roster, Marshall has increasingly operated as a secondary creator and occasional lead ball-handler, a responsibility he embraced again Thursday.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I think just reps helped us a lot,\u201d Marshall said. \u201cCooper obviously doing his thing, just learning how to feed off him and be helpful for him.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Marshall attacked closeouts, finished in transition and knocked down four three-pointers, tying his career high. Yet he deflected individual praise afterward, choosing instead to highlight Flagg\u2019s influence.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cCooper inspired me,\u201d Marshall said. \u201cHe\u2019s on a rampage right now. He had 30 again tonight, so just trying to match his energy.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>When asked whether the attention once given to high-scoring duos of the past should apply to their recent run, Marshall smiled.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cLet Coop have all the shine,\u201d he said. \u201cI\u2019m cool with being Robin.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Facing Victor Wembanyama\u2019s Length<\/p>\n<p>For Flagg, the night also offered another lesson in navigating elite size and defensive range. Wembanyama\u2019s ability to contest shots from the rim to the perimeter forced quicker decisions and altered shot selection throughout the game.<\/p>\n<p>Flagg said facing Wembanyama requires a level of decisiveness that few matchups demand, particularly when the Spurs center is covering ground from the perimeter to the rim.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t is different,\u201d Flagg said. \u201cYou\u2019ve got to get your shot up and get it up quick, or he\u2019s coming to block it every time.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>That awareness extended to Flagg\u2019s playmaking. A wraparound pass to <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/m\/martica02.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Caleb Martin<\/a> for a corner three was among several reads that reflected his expanding role as a facilitator.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They were helping all the way in off him,\u201d Flagg said. \u201cJust trying to make the right play.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Kidd echoed that growth. \u201cBeing 6-9 with the ability to find open guys is at a high level,\u201d he said. \u201cHe\u2019s showing that on a daily basis.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Historic Production by Cooper Flagg, Broader Context<\/p>\n<p>With his latest performance, Flagg joined a rare group of rookies to score at least 30 points in four consecutive games, a list that includes <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/j\/jordami01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Michael Jordan<\/a>, <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/i\/iversal01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Allen Iverson<\/a>, <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/k\/kingbe01.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Bernard King<\/a>, and <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/g\/greenja05.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Jalen Green<\/a>. Over his last four games, Flagg is averaging 37.8 points, 9.3 rebounds, and 4.5 assists, numbers that underscore how quickly his role has expanded.<\/p>\n<p>Flagg attributed that surge not to any single adjustment, but to routine and discipline.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I think that\u2019s a big thing that I\u2019ve learned,\u201d he said. \u201cGetting a good routine in place and sticking to it.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>That routine, Kidd said, reflects a broader maturity.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cFilm, coachable \u2014 all of them,\u201d Kidd said. \u201cYou tell him one thing, and he can add it. For a 19-year-old to be able to do those things is really special.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Dallas Mavericks Face Deadline Fallout and a Reset in Motion<\/p>\n<p>Thursday\u2019s game was also Dallas\u2019 first since trading <a r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/www.basketball-reference.com\/players\/d\/davisan02.html?utm_medium=linker&amp;utm_source=dallashoopsjournal.com&amp;utm_campaign=2026-02-06_bbr\">Anthony Davis<\/a>, a move that formalized a reset already taking shape. Davis appeared in just 29 games as a Maverick due to injuries, a reality Kidd addressed candidly.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t was unfortunate,\u201d Kidd said. \u201cWe never got to see everyone together. But AD is an incredible basketball player and a great human being. We wish him the best.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Marshall, who spoke emotionally about the departures of Davis and other teammates, framed the moment as another reminder of the league\u2019s volatility.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e league\u2019s very unpredictable,\u201d he said. \u201cBut at the end of the day, you still gotta show up and do your job.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>A Long Runway Ahead<\/p>\n<p>The loss dropped Dallas further in the standings, but the organization\u2019s longer view is coming into sharper focus. Flagg is no longer simply a promising rookie; he is already shaping how the Mavericks compete, adjust, and imagine what comes next.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e runway is long,\u201d Kidd said. \u201cHe\u2019s developing an understanding of the NBA game, the schedule, the physicality. Now it\u2019s for us to find the pieces that fit.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>For Dallas, Thursday night was another step through a difficult stretch. For Flagg, it was another marker in a season that continues to redefine expectations \u2014 and to signal where the franchise is headed next.<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/dallashoopsjournal.com\/p\/category\/dallas-mavericks\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Latest Dallas Mavericks News &amp; NBA Rumors<\/a><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"The scoreboard told one story Thursday night at American Airlines Center.
